MotherDuck

MotherDuck

MotherDuck is a serverless cloud data warehouse built on DuckDB, offering a hybrid execution architecture to help data teams collaborate efficiently and handle TB-scale data analytics tasks.
DuckDB cloud data warehouseserverless data analytics platformhybrid-execution data queriesMotherDuck data collaborationTB-scale data processing solutionembedded analytics application development

Features of MotherDuck

Offers a hybrid architecture with intelligent distribution of queries between local and cloud execution
Serverless model—analyze data without managing infrastructure
Supports connections to external data sources such as S3, enabling joined queries across local and cloud data
Optimized with DuckDB columnar storage to ensure low-latency interactive analytics
Provides an isolated compute instance per user, enabling resource isolation and cost attribution

Use Cases of MotherDuck

For data analysts to quickly explore data and perform ad-hoc analyses, executing interactive SQL queries
When data engineers build department-level data marts, simplifying data sharing and teamwork
Developers building web applications can embed low-latency data analytics using the Wasm SDK
Data scientists handling large-scale datasets can seamlessly bridge local and cloud compute resources

FAQ about MotherDuck

QWhat is MotherDuck?

MotherDuck is a cloud-native, serverless data warehouse and analytics platform built on DuckDB, designed to deliver high-performance, collaborative data solutions for teams through a hybrid execution architecture.

QWhat are the main advantages of MotherDuck?

Its main advantages lie in combining DuckDB's portability with the scalability of the cloud, offering a serverless architecture, hybrid query execution, and cost-effective processing of data from hundreds of GB up to TB-scale.

QHow can I connect MotherDuck to cloud data?

Users can authenticate by providing the database name and service token, connect via the MotherDuck Web UI, DuckDB CLI, or third-party tools, and directly query external data sources like S3.

QWhich user groups is MotherDuck suitable for?

It suits software engineers, data scientists, data analysts, and data engineers—professional teams that require efficient data collaboration, ad-hoc analysis, or building embedded analytics applications.

QHow does MotherDuck handle data privacy and security?

MotherDuck uses a per-tenant model, provisioning independent serverless compute instances for each user to achieve compute isolation, and secures data with authentication and authorization mechanisms.

QWhat data formats does MotherDuck support?

It supports reading Parquet, CSV, JSON, and other data formats, and allows joining local and cloud data for queries and analysis.

Similar Tools

MongoDB

MongoDB

MongoDB is a modern document-oriented database platform. Its flagship cloud offering, MongoDB Atlas, provides a fully managed database service. Atlas includes native vector search capabilities to help developers build generative-AI-powered applications and to support enterprises in modernizing data management and system architecture.

Databricks AI

Databricks AI

Databricks AI is an enterprise-grade, unified data and AI platform built on a lakehouse architecture. It brings data management, analytics and AI development into one workflow—letting teams move from raw data to production-ready intelligent apps faster, with consistent governance across any cloud.

InfluxDB

InfluxDB

InfluxDB is a leading time-series database designed for high-performance ingestion, storage, and real-time analytics of massive time-series data, enabling data-driven decision-making across industrial IoT, IT operations monitoring, and other domains.

T

TeradataAI

TeradataAI gives enterprises cloud-scale analytics plus production-grade AI: parallel SQL, built-in governance, and native vector search—deployed anywhere you need data sovereignty.

TransDuck

TransDuck

TransDuck is an AI-powered cloud SaaS platform for automated audio and video translation, dubbing, and subtitle processing, helping creators and businesses streamline multilingual content production.

dstack

dstack

dstack is a container orchestration platform for AI/ML teams, offering a unified control plane to simplify the end-to-end workflow from development and training to deployment, helping teams efficiently manage GPU resources and significantly reduce costs.

Ducky AI Search

Ducky AI Search

Ducky is a fully managed AI search infrastructure platform that supports RAG technology, helping development teams quickly build intelligent search applications over private data, while significantly lowering the technical barrier and operational costs.

A

AgentDock AI

AgentDock delivers an enterprise-grade visual builder and runtime for AI agents—helping teams configure workflows in plain English, plug in multiple models, and speed up internal automation & knowledge management.

Hoody AI

Hoody AI

Hoody AI is a real-time, containerized AI computing platform that combines embedding, automation, and orchestration to deliver easy-to-use AI integration and automation solutions for developers and businesses, accelerating development and productivity.

MindsDB

MindsDB

MindsDB is an open-source AI data platform that lets developers and analysts query data from 200+ sources with plain English or SQL, build ML-powered apps, and get real-time insights—no complex pipeline required.